    Add 50-80 grams of soybeans and products per day, including 5-20 grams of fermented soybean products. Soy is rich in high-quality protein, unsaturated fatty acids and B vitamins. It is an important food for vegetarians, and its consumption should be guaranteed. Soybeans and cereals can be eaten together to play the complementary role of protein and improve the nutritional value of protein. Soy products include soy milk, tofu, dried tofu, tofu skin, soybean sprouts, etc. Fermented soybean products contain vitamin B12. Common foods include fermented bean curd, tempeh, bean paste, and soy sauce. Eating three meals a day can easily meet the recommended intake of soy foods.
